I don't like them, either. I understand where your friends are coming from, though, because I felt intense pressure from lenders to buy a PT Cruiser when I was looking for a new car four years ago. The banks are wrong, though. I did a lot of research before deciding which vehicle to buy and the PT Cruisers just don't hold their value. According to this article: http://www.thetruthaboutcars.com/2008/06/pt-cruiser/ (http://www.thetruthaboutcars.com/2008/06/pt-cruiser/) Pt Cruisers lose an estimated 63% of their purchase value over the first five years. Admittedly, the article is a couple of years old, but still...
By comparison, Liam and I have a 2007 Mustang GT and it's holding value very well. The dealership it came from has offered to buy it back a couple of times and the car was only down about 22% at the time of the last offer. We're not selling it, though.
